Axtria Contracts Specialist Salaries in Boulder

The average Axtria Contracts Specialist in Boulder earns an estimated $79,291 annually. Axtria's Contracts Specialist compensation is $5,855 less than the US average for a Contracts Specialist.

In Boulder, The Legal Department at Axtria earns $21,445 more on average than the HR Department.
